10 pc Takoyaki - for $10. Worth it. Fresh & hot. Nothing bad but also nothing great. Sukiyaki beef udon - perfect for winter. Flavor was good. Beef was tender and had a good quantity. Would order again. Ginya Don - fresh fish and quality rice. Would order again. Kushiyaki (grilled skewers) - mixed flavors and omakase style which I approve. It was very tasty. Especially the bacon. Friends got the ramen…idk how it tasted but here’s some pictures. Lol~

What a great place for Japanese food, the service was great and the food just right. It’s got plenty of seating for a small building, but no outdoor seat is available. There is a small bar inside and seats so you can watch the food being prepared. The location does have booths, tables and a traditional table where you must take your shoes off and sit in the floor. They are always busy so plan ahead, but it’s worth the wait
